Boston Public Library (Rare Books Department) copy included in a "bound-with" volume of works on the French Revolution. Copy quarter-bound in marbled papers and tan leather over boards. Spine title in gilt over red leather square. Spine includes decorative device of the Boston Public Library in gilt near tail. Front pastedown includes ex libris (bookplate) of the Boston Public Library (featuring the seal of the city of Boston), including accession number, shelf number, and accession date in (faded to brown) black ink script. Front matter includes collective title page, bearing the seal of the city of Boston at its head, with "Pamphlets. French Revolution" in black ink script. Leaf following collective title page bears shelf number, accession number, and accession date in pencil. Rear pastedown includes partial remnants of affixed library due date label, & blue ink stamp of the Boston Public Library Bindery (dated "OCT 8 1881") at head-/fore-edge. Copy printed on antique laid papers featuring vertical chainlines and horiztonal wire lines. Title page includes markings at head in black ink script
